Abstract
Two coryneform bacteria isolated from human clinical specimens were characterized by phenotypic and molecular taxonomic methods. Chemotaxonomic investigations revealed the presence of cell-wall chemotype IV and short-chain mycolic acids consistent with the genus Corynebacterium sensu stricto. Comparative 16S rRNA gene sequence analysis showed that the two strains are genealogically highly related (99.8% sequence similarity) and constitute a new subline within the genus Corynebacterium, with Corynebacterium minutissimum as their nearest phylogenetic neighbours (98.8% sequence similarity). However, DNA-DNA hybridization experiments demonstrated unambiguously that the isolates are genealogically distinct from Corynebacterium minutissimum (42% homology). Biochemical testing indicated that the two isolates were hardly differentiated from Corynebacterium minutissimum. Based on both phenotypic and phylogenetic evidence it is proposed that these isolates be classified as a new species, Corynebacterium aurimucosum sp. nov. The type strain of Corynebacterium aurimucosum is represented by strain IMMIB D-1488T (= DSM 44532T = NRRL B-24143T).Entities:
